“I was born in Bensonhurst, Brooklyn and moved to Staten Island at two years old but my family was all still in Brooklyn. I miss Sunday dinners at my nonna’s house.
My last 5 years at the Brooklyn Museum have been quite amazing. I’ve met some really great people and made lifelong friends. I’ve even met my husband here <3
My favorite piece of art is our Della Robbia. Being raised in a Catholic home, my mom had statues of Jesus and the Blessed Mother. It reminds me of my mom.”
—Tina Marie, Security
